WinMySQL安装是许多Windows用户搭建MySQL数据库环境时需要掌握的基础技能,本文将详细介绍WinMySQL的安装步骤、注意事项及常见问题,帮助用户顺利完成配置。

安装前准备
在开始安装WinMySQL之前,需要确保系统满足以下基本要求:
- 操作系统:支持Windows XP/7/8/10及更高版本,32位或64位均可。
- 硬件配置:建议至少1GB内存,500MB可用磁盘空间。
- 依赖组件:需安装Microsoft Visual C++运行库(根据MySQL版本选择对应版本)。
建议从MySQL官网或可信源下载最新稳定版的WinMySQL安装包,避免使用非官方渠道提供的可能存在安全风险的版本。
安装步骤详解
WinMySQL的安装过程相对简单,但需注意细节以确保配置正确。
运行安装程序
双击下载的安装包(如WinMySQL-installer.exe),启动安装向导,点击“Next”进入下一步,阅读许可协议后勾选同意,继续操作。

选择安装类型
安装程序通常会提供两种安装模式:
- Typical(典型安装):推荐新手使用,自动安装常用组件到默认路径。
- Custom(自定义安装):高级用户可选择自定义安装路径和组件(如仅安装服务器或客户端工具)。
| 安装类型 | 适用人群 | 特点 |
|---|---|---|
| Typical | 初学者 | 自动配置,无需手动干预 |
| Custom | 高级用户 | 可自定义路径和组件选择 |
配置MySQL参数
在安装过程中,需设置以下关键参数:
- Root密码:设置数据库管理员密码,建议包含字母、数字和特殊字符,长度不少于8位。
- 服务名称:默认为“WinMySQL”,可根据需要修改,但需确保与后续配置一致。
- 端口设置:默认端口为3306,若与其他服务冲突可修改为其他未被占用的端口(如3307)。
完成安装
点击“Install”开始复制文件并配置服务,安装完成后,系统会提示是否启动MySQL服务,建议勾选“Start MySQL Service”并点击“Finish”结束安装。
安装后验证
安装完成后,需通过以下步骤验证MySQL是否正常运行:

- 检查服务状态:打开“服务”管理器(
services.msc),查找“WinMySQL”服务,确保其状态为“正在运行”。 - 登录测试:使用MySQL客户端工具(如MySQL Workbench)输入root密码尝试连接,若成功则表示安装成功。
- 命令行测试:打开命令提示符,输入
mysql -u root -p,输入密码后若进入MySQL命令行界面,则验证通过。
常见问题与解决
- 安装失败提示“MSVCR120.dll缺失”
解决方法:下载并安装对应版本的Visual C++ Redistributable(如2013版本)。 - 服务无法启动
解决方法:检查端口是否被占用,或通过日志文件(通常位于安装目录的data文件夹)定位错误原因。
FAQs
Q1:忘记root密码怎么办?
A1:可通过以下步骤重置密码:
- 停止MySQL服务;
- 以安全模式启动MySQL(命令行添加
--skip-grant-tables参数); - 登录后执行
UPDATE mysql.user SET password=PASSWORD('新密码') WHERE User='root';; - 重启MySQL服务即可。
Q2:如何卸载WinMySQL?
A2:卸载步骤如下:
- 通过“控制面板”中的“程序和功能”找到WinMySQL并卸载;
- 手动删除残留文件(如安装目录下的MySQL文件夹);
- 清理注册表(可选,建议使用专业工具)。
【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!
发表回复